Patna, June 2, 2025: A day after the attack on outgoing Patliputra BJP MP Ram Kripal Yadav, Bihar Deputy Chief Minister Samrat Choudhary said that strict action would be taken against those involved in the incident.
Samrat Choudhary alleged that RJD people were behind the attack:
Accusing the RJD of desperation amid fears of electoral defeat, Samrat Choudhary said, “RJD is disappointed with the expected loss in this Lok Sabha election and hence their people attacked our MP. The people of Bihar have rejected the RJD and the Grand Alliance, and now they have resorted to hooliganism. Those who attacked Ram Kripal Yadav are RJD goons.”
He added that the Bihar police has constituted an SIR to probe the case and accused that no accused will be allowed to escape.
Apart from Samrat Choudhary, Giriraj Singh also condemned the incident:
Begusarai MP Giriraj Singh also condemned the incident, calling the attack an act of desperation.
Ram Kripal Yadav was attacked around 7.30 pm on Saturday at Gopalpur Math village under Masaudhi police station in Patna district.
He alleged that he, his sons, and BJP supporters were targeted by RJD workers.
“They attacked me, my sons, and BJP supporters. This was done out of fear of defeat. Our workers were also attacked in Bikram, Danapur, Paliganj, and Dhanarua during and after polling.
I fear how many more attacks will take place after the election results,” he said.
Arrest and FIR:
Patna Police on Sunday arrested one accused, identified as Vikas Yadav of Gopalpur Math village.
Police confirmed that two people were injured in the incident, though none suffered serious injuries.
